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
709 86690321 3197 3424971429 94
62320 73288518 0195007
62320 73288518 0195007
7993351200 16942480161 14453350158 058106
All about undefined
Interested in learning more?
62320 73288518 0195007
7993351200 16942480161 14453350158 058106
See more
331093310 7768
985 8433515 7228084715
See more
771693184 54287957849 6460044
300 696 74 23354
See more